The optimization of a multicloud architecture, basically place, is the means to configure the technologies to enhance the architecture for the business prerequisites, as very well as to minimize expenditures. For every single dollar put in on cloud technologies, you want the optimum price coming again to the business.
The truth is that handful of cloud architectures are entirely optimized. I’ve talked about the bias towards complexity as a major offender. Nevertheless, the root result in is ready to assume about architecture optimization until finally it is deployed and in procedure. By then, it is much too late.
So, what are the major explanations that multicloud architecture falls way quick of currently being entirely optimized? In this article are just three, and how to tackle them:
Leveraging much too considerably technologies. A cousin to complexity is extra. Multicloud architects and progress teams frequently attempt to toss as considerably technologies as they can into the multicloud combine, commonly for all types of prerequisites that “might” materialize. You could will need only a person service governance technologies, but you’re working with three. You can get absent with a person storage source, but you have got 7. You stop up with far more charge and no additional price to the business.
This is a tricky issue to solve since most architects are trying to build for a future that has not arrived yet. They decide a database with crafted-in mirroring technologies since they could move to entirely dispersed databases, even though almost certainly not for numerous far more decades. So the variety of database types goes from two to four without having a definitely excellent explanation. Hold in thoughts that you should really be developing for “minimum viability” to get close to an optimized state.
Not developing for specific prerequisites. Requirements—strict, specific, quick requirements—are very well recognized since they generally determine what your multicloud architecture will be. They outline the styles of complications that the architecture desires to solve. Nevertheless, I see a huge variety of multicloud jobs that are trying to layout and build for common prerequisites that have tiny basis in what the business desires now.
I know this is the “it depends” solution that individuals despise from us consultants. Nevertheless, in buy to move towards complete optimization, the prerequisites determine your minimum amount practical multicloud architecture, not the other way round.
Not architecting for improve. Those people billed with developing multiclouds, even if they are approaching complete optimization, frequently neglect to fully grasp how to layout for agility. In this article, agility means understanding that component of the architecture desires to adapt quickly to variations that will take place in the future. Numerous architecture tricks carry out this, and the primary concepts are pretty easy to fully grasp.
Make guaranteed to put volatility into a domain. You are searching to prevent a finish redo of a database or software all over uncomplicated variations, for example. Say you’re leveraging data virtualization in between the databases and programs, letting you to improve the digital schema as lots of periods as you will need to use a mapping device, without having forcing highly-priced and risky variations to the actual physical databases in the multicloud.
This is a little bit different than deploying much too considerably technologies, because change—including the degree and frequency—is itself a need. This is not about assuming or hedging bets.
Architecture carries on to be far more art than science. Nevertheless, by understanding the rising very best methods, individuals coming up with and developing multiclouds can return considerably far more price to the business. That’s the objective.
Copyright © 2021 IDG Communications, Inc.